Abstract
Packing materials for a module of a display apparatus for protecting the module, and an assembly structure are described as below. The packing materials for the module of the display apparatus comprise a plane frame, a side frame, a combination unit, a guiding unit, and a support means. The plane frame has an opening in its center. The side frame is formed to be connected along the surrounding of the plane frame in the direction approximately perpendicular to the plane frame. The combination unit is formed on the rear surface of the plane frame. The guiding unit is inserted in the combination unit and fixes one and more of edges on the plane frame. The support means is integrally formed with the guiding unit. In addition, the assembly structure comprises a plurality of packing materials for the module of the display apparatus, a plurality of modules for the display apparatus, and paper angle units. At this time, the packing materials for the module of the display apparatus is as mentioned above. Accordingly, the module for the display apparatus is formed between the packing materials for the module of the display apparatus. The paper angle unit is formed on the side surface or edge outside the plane frame and side frame.

Claims
  • 1. Packing materials for a module of a display apparatus comprising: a plane frame having an opening in its center;a side frame formed to be connected to the plane frame in the direction approximately perpendicular to the circumference of the plane frame;a combination unit formed on the rear surface of the plane frame; anda guiding unit inserted in the combination unit.
  • 2. The packing materials for the module of the display apparatus of claim 1, wherein the plane frame and the side frame are integrally formed with each other.
  • 3. The packing materials for the module of the display apparatus of claim 2, wherein the plane frame and the side frame are made of a thermoplastic-based material.
  • 4. The packing materials for the module of the display apparatus of claim 3, wherein the thermoplastic-based material is any one of an expandable polystyrene, an expandable polypropylene, and an expandable polyethylene.
  • 5. The packing materials for the module of the display apparatus of claim 1, wherein the guiding unit is formed on one and more of edges on the plane frame and fixes the plane frame.
  • 6. The packing materials for the module of the display apparatus of claim 1, wherein the guiding unit has a form to correspond to the edge of the plane frame.
  • 7. The packing materials for the module of the display apparatus of claim 1, wherein the combination unit has a groove form.
  • 8. The packing materials for the module of the display apparatus of claim 1, wherein one and more protrusions are formed on the plane frame inside the guiding unit.
  • 9. The packing materials for the module of the display apparatus of claim 8, wherein a support means is combined to the protrusion to suppress a horizontal movement of the module.
  • 10. The packing materials for the module of the display apparatus of claims 8 or 9, wherein the support means and guiding unit are made of any one of plastics, metals, and nonferrous metals.
  • 11. The packing materials for the module of the display apparatus of claim 9, wherein the support means is integrally formed with the guiding unit.
  • 12. The packing materials for the module of the display apparatus of claim 9, wherein the support means has a plurality of holes, any one of the holes being inserted in the protrusion.
  • 13. The packing materials for the module of the display apparatus of claim 11, wherein the module comprises a first fixing means, the fixing means combined to other holes formed on the support means.
  • 14. The packing materials for the module of the display apparatus of claim 1 further comprising at least one and more damping units on the rear surface of the plane frame.
  • 15. The packing materials for the module of the display apparatus of claim 14, wherein the module comprises a second fixing means,the damping units are placed on the second fixing means.
  • 16. An assembly structure comprising: packing materials for a module of a display apparatus comprising a plane frame having an opening in its center, a side frame formed to be connected to the plane frame in the direction approximately perpendicular to the circumference of the plane frame, a combination unit formed on the rear surface of the plane frame, and a guiding unit fixing the plane frame inserted in the combination unit and formed on one and more of edges of the plane frame; anda module for a display apparatus arranged between the packing materials for the module.
  • 17. The assembly structure of claim 16, wherein the plane frame and the side frame are made of a thermoplastic-based material.
  • 18. The assembly structure of claim 16 further comprising: a paper angle unit for protecting the plane frame and the side frame.
  • 19. The assembly structure of claim 18, wherein the paper angle unit is formed on a side surface or edge outside the plane frame and side frame.
  • 20. The assembly structure of claim 18, wherein the paper angle unit and guiding unit are made of any one of plastics, metals, and nonferrous metals.
